Output 1076b6cb50ca0397800e3a36920b73fbb98f6db38b8cf9e6c5af01372f135080:7

value
1010868
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5d2b5b15f09fb8d36336e20afe98e5d8a15cce0a OP_EQUAL
address
3ABehoEoXjBXW3ikzpcVS3t6dCPvcG2CBd
transaction
1076b6cb50ca0397800e3a36920b73fbb98f6db38b8cf9e6c5af01372f135080
spent
true